As a Substance Misuse Nurse, your responsibilities will vary. You will

  • Work as part of a multi-disciplinary team, prioritising patient care to develop individualised packages of care through comprehensive assessment and recovery planning
  • Deliver a range of treatment options including clinical and psychosocial interventions in both a group and 1-1 setting with recovery at the centre of our healthcare wellbeing model
  • Be able to carry out comprehensive assessments, initiate and review individual recovery plans and confidently communicate the full range of treatment options available to service users.
  • Monitor therapeutic responses to medication and potential side effects and liaise with prescribers. You will work with individuals, on a 1-1 basis, providing advice and information
  • Support in group work delivery and liaise with prescribers and Recovery Practitioners on clinical interventions. You will occasionally be required to support dispensing
  • Have an understanding and commitment to recovery and a person centred approach.

    We are looking for a dedicated and compassionate Substance Misuse Nurse with previous experience working with patients experiencing substance misuse issues. Ideally, you will already hold RCGGP Level 1 in Substance Misuse; however, candidates who do not currently have this qualification but are willing to undertake the training will also be considered. You will be based in the healthcare department and some expectations to work on the wings. Hours, We are looking for caring, compassionate but also driven professionals who can help us drive our vision for a fair and inclusive healthcare access to all.
  • Registered nurse with current NMC registration.
  • Evidence of Continued Professional Development (CPD).
  • RCGP 1 in Substance Misuse or willingness to undertake.
  • Experience of working with opiate dependant patients.
  • Sound clinical substance misuse knowledge.
  • A non-judgmental and compassionate approach.
  • Although not essential ideal applicants would have experience in a hospital, community or prison environment.
